Alton Towers has launched a £1m driving adventure attraction for children under the age of 10 years.
The Peugeot 207 Driving School comprises a road adventure course featuring miniature electric versions of the Peugeot 207.
Children can choose their own route and attempt to tackle traffic lights, roundabouts and crossroads as well as more quirky features such as a bubble-blasting car wash and evading of gigantic hedgehogs rambling over a zebra crossing.
An advanced section allows drivers to test their skills on a slalom challenge and gain an Alton Towers driving licence.
In addition, Alton Towers Hotel is set to launch the UK’s first ‘sleepover suite’ on 7 July. The six-person, sound-proofed guest suite will cater for 7 to 14-year-old girls on a sleepover party.
The suite will comprise bright pink chill-out beds, a home entertainment system, a plasma TV, a mini-dance floor and a karaoke area as well as a pink fridge filled with ice cream and chocolate. Details: www.altontowers.com
